#courses { /*width:630px;*/ height:270px; margin:0 0 10px 0; padding:0;}
#courses .jcarousel { position:relative; overflow:hidden; width:630px; height:263px;}
#courses ul { width:20000em; position:absolute; list-style:none; margin:0; padding:0; height:263px; border:none;}
#courses li.jcarousel { float:left; width:203px; margin-right:10px; border:none; top:0px; }

	#courses .mediaboxOpacity { position:absolute; z-index:2; width:100%; height:28px; background:#000; bottom:67px; left:0; opacity:0.6; -moz-opacity:0.6; -webkit-opacity:0.6; filter:Alpha(Opacity=60) }
	#courses .mediaboxSubtitle { /*height:35px;*/ z-index:3; bottom:67px; left:0; }
	/*#courses .mediaboxSubtitle h4.categorie { margin-top:10px; margin-bottom:0; font-size:12px; text-transform:uppercase; font-weight: normal; }
	#courses .mediaboxSubtitle h4.categorie, #courses .mediaboxSubtitle h4.categorie a { color:#CCCCCC; text-decoration:none; line-height: 20px; }*/
	#courses .mediaboxSubtitle h3.title { margin-top:0; font-weight:bold; }
	#courses .mediaboxSubtitle h3.title, #courses .mediaboxSubtitle h3.title a { color:#000; text-decoration:none; font-size:14px; padding-top: 5px; }
	#courses .mediaboxSubtitle h4.categorie, #courses .mediaboxSubtitle h3.title { /*margin-left:5px; margin-right:5px; */}
	#courses .mediaboxContent { color: #000; }
